Before celebrating, going to see the dancers, our driver friend wants to enter the temple to pray for us. We decided to join him. He explains their belief in three gods who form one (the Sun God, god of water or soil air and God. Before leaving Emy was sad to have lost birds made by Kadet as present for the temple. Fortunately our friend had planned the coup, he gives us each a small arrangement of flowers. In the temple of the hundreds of people gathered, and they knelt before each of us files a stick of incense smoke. He explains that we will do 5 short prayers. The first joined hands to open and empty our souls and the second with the pink flowers in their hands to God, then the 3rd with the blue flowers for the temple, the 4th with 2 kinds of flowers for the community, for everything that is to be good in the world and the 5th to thank God and thank life. Fortunately these are only very short prayers. After the prayers we put flowers in their hair. Then it's a blessing. My friend tells me that many people are here and priests marrying their wives also automatically become a priest. These priests pass through the rows of people kneeling directly on the ground barefoot. (Whew, it's super hard on my knee not fully healed) and bless them with water "holly spring. A blessing to be lucky. With his English and mine, I hope it is understandable. The priest pours water and drink the Hindu three times, then the fourth one is poured onto the head to cleanse, to refresh, cleanse, and make new provisions. Then on his forehead sticks some grains of rice then it is also the solar plexus and you eat one or two. Emy wants to lend to the ritual when Eve refused. Provided that the water is good ... I am assured that it is pure water.
